Understanding the Basics of Vehicle Customization
What is Vehicle Customization in GTA?
Vehicle customization in GTA allows players to modify various aspects of their cars, motorcycles, and other vehicles. This includes enhancements in performance (engine upgrades, suspension tuning, etc.) and aesthetic modifications (paint jobs, body kits, etc.). Mastering these customizations can give players a strategic advantage in missions and races.

Performance Upgrades
Engine Upgrades
One of the best ways to push your vehicle’s performance is through engine upgrades. Players can increase their vehicle’s horsepower and torque, giving them a speed boost in races or pursuits.
- Level 1 to Level 4 Upgrades: Higher levels yield more powerful engines capable of higher speeds.
Suspension and Handling
Tuning your suspension can drastically improve gameplay, particularly when cornering.
- Stiff Suspension: Reduces body roll during sharp turns, making it easier to control your vehicle at high speeds.
- Soft Suspension: Best for off-road driving, as it allows for better shock absorption.
Brake Upgrades
Upgrading brakes should not be overlooked. Enhanced brakes can mean the difference between stopping in time to avoid a collision or going careening into traffic.
- Standard Brakes: Adequate for casual gameplay.
- Race Brakes: Optimal for performance driving, offering quicker stops and better control.
Tire Options
Choosing the right tires can influence handling and grip on the asphalt.
- Performance Tires: Enhance grip during high-speed pursuits.
- Off-Road Tires: Ideal for navigating rough terrain or tracks.

GTA Vehicle Customization Locations
To access mod shops in the game, look for the following locations:
- Los Santos Customs
- Benny’s Original Motor Works (for more intricate car modifications)
- Custom Auto Shops in different locales in Los Santos.
